Risultati da 1 a 7 di 7

Discussione: Raggruppare celle piene sparse nella stessa colonna



  1. #1

    L'avatar di ges
    Clicca e Apri
    Data Registrazione
    Jun 2015
    Località
    Como
    Età
    54
    Messaggi
    10793
    Versione Office
    2011MAC 2016WIN
    Likes ricevuti
    2698
    Likes dati
    1592

    Raggruppare celle piene sparse nella stessa colonna

    Salve a tutti e un saluto a Gerardo Zuccalà che seguo da tempo su you tube da tempo al quale rinnovo i ringraziamenti per questo forum.

    Ho il seguente problema che non riesco a risolvere.

    Ho una lista di circa mille prodotti, che ho bisogno di tenere rigorosamente in un certo ordine, ogni prodotto è associato a dei nominativi che mi devono inviare dei dati, pertanto ho aggiunto alle celle adiacenti a ciascun prodotto la formula =SE(C2<>"";"";"B2") (in D2, D3, ecc. inserisco il dato che mi inviano, in E2, E3, c'è il nome corrispondente a quel dato, che "sparisce" quando il dato viene inserito).

    A questo punto mi trovo con una cinquantina di dati mancanti e quindi altrettanti nomi sparsi nella lunga lista di excel, vorrei trovare un modo con le formule (non usando macro) di avere i nomi mancati uno dietro l'altro eliminando quindi le celle che risultano vuote.

    Allego un'immagine come esempio (in D2,D3,D4,D5 c'è la formula sopra riportata)

  2. #2
    L'avatar di Stefano
    Clicca e Apri
    Data Registrazione
    May 2015
    Località
    Turbigo (MI)
    Età
    53
    Messaggi
    186
    Versione Office
    Excel 2013
    Likes ricevuti
    1
    la prima cosa che mi viene in mente è che se la formatti come tabella, poi fai ordina ti porta i dati in alto

  3. #3
    L'avatar di Canapone
    Clicca e Apri
    Data Registrazione
    Jun 2015
    Località
    Firenze
    Messaggi
    1170
    Versione Office
    2010 su Win
    Likes ricevuti
    688
    Likes dati
    249
    Ciao a tutti,

    un possibile approccio


    =SE.ERRORE(INDICE($B$2:$B$1000;AGGREGA(15;6;RIF.RIGA($A$2:$A$1000)-1/($C$2:$C$1000="");RIF.RIGA(A1)));"")&""

    La colonna D (dati mancanti) non viene letta dalla formula.

    Saluti

  4. #4
    L'avatar di Gerardo Zuccalà
    Clicca e Apri
    Data Registrazione
    May 2015
    Località
    Milano, Italy
    Età
    50
    Messaggi
    5391
    Versione Office
    office 365/2016
    Likes ricevuti
    1276
    Likes dati
    1349
    Ciao Ges
    Grazie per la domanda
    un consiglio.. quando inserisci un griglia o tabella come questa , ti consiglio (se puoi se vuoi) di non inserire immagini in formato .gif .png .jpg perchè non sono direttamente trascrivibile in excel e di conseguenza si perde tempo a copiare tutto i dataset, indi per cui ti consiglio di usare il
    il bbcode per griglie e bordi che è direttamante copiabile in excel, se non sai come fare clicca qui nella mia firma e ti farò vedere. ciao
    Se non lo sai spiegare in modo semplice, non l'hai capito abbastanza bene Cit. Einstein

  5. #5
    L'avatar di Gerardo Zuccalà
    Clicca e Apri
    Data Registrazione
    May 2015
    Località
    Milano, Italy
    Età
    50
    Messaggi
    5391
    Versione Office
    office 365/2016
    Likes ricevuti
    1276
    Likes dati
    1349
    Citazione Originariamente Scritto da Canapone Visualizza Messaggio
    Ciao a tutti,
    Ciao canapone ho preso spunto dalla tua formula per fare una variante per coloro che hanno la versione di excel 2007 e precedenti che non hanno la funzione AGGREGA
    per far funzionare queste formule bisogna attivarle con i tasti CTRL+SHIFT+ENTER


    in F2:
    =SE.ERRORE(INDICE($B$2:$B$5;PICCOLO(SE($C$2:$C$5<>"";RIF.RIGA($A$2:$A$5)-RIF.RIGA($A$2)+1);RIGHE($A$1:A1)));"")


    in G2:
    =SE.ERRORE(INDICE($A$2:$A$5;PICCOLO(SE($C$2:$C$5<>"";RIF.RIGA($A$2:$A$5)-RIF.RIGA($A$2)+1);RIGHE($A$1:A1)));"")

    in H2:
    =SE.ERRORE(INDICE($C$2:$C$5;PICCOLO(SE($C$2:$C$5<>"";RIF.RIGA($A$2:$A$5)-RIF.RIGA($A$2)+1);RIGHE($A$1:A1)));"")

    Excel 2013
    Row\Col
    A
    B
    C
    D
    E
    F
    G
    H
    1
    Prodotto Nome quantita Nome Prodotto quantità
    2
    Matita rossa Mario Rossi
    12
    Mario Rossi Matita rossa
    12
    3
    matita verde Marco Bianchi Giulio verdi penna blu
    34
    4
    penna blu Giulio verdi
    34
    5
    penna rossa Matteo Neri
    Sheet: Foglio3
    Se non lo sai spiegare in modo semplice, non l'hai capito abbastanza bene Cit. Einstein

  6. #6

    L'avatar di ges
    Clicca e Apri
    Data Registrazione
    Jun 2015
    Località
    Como
    Età
    54
    Messaggi
    10793
    Versione Office
    2011MAC 2016WIN
    Likes ricevuti
    2698
    Likes dati
    1592
    Ragazzi... che dire .. siete fantastici!!!!
    Grazie per avermi risolto il problema.
    Ges

    P.S. - Gerardo, scusami per il file jpeg la prossima volta vedrò di usare il bbcode per griglie e bordi. Grazie

  7. #7
    L'avatar di Gerardo Zuccalà
    Clicca e Apri
    Data Registrazione
    May 2015
    Località
    Milano, Italy
    Età
    50
    Messaggi
    5391
    Versione Office
    office 365/2016
    Likes ricevuti
    1276
    Likes dati
    1349
    Citazione Originariamente Scritto da ges Visualizza Messaggio
    Ragazzi... che dire .. siete fantastici!!!!
    Grazie per avermi risolto il problema.
    Ges

    P.S. - Gerardo, scusami per il file jpeg la prossima volta vedrò di usare il bbcode per griglie e bordi. Grazie
    Prego e torna quando Vuoi!
    Se non lo sai spiegare in modo semplice, non l'hai capito abbastanza bene Cit. Einstein

Discussioni Simili

  1. Risposte: 13
    Ultimo Messaggio: 02/03/17, 10:45
  2. Sommare celle in base a condizioni nella stessa riga
    Di Bubamara nel forum Domande su Excel in generale
    Risposte: 13
    Ultimo Messaggio: 23/11/16, 13:18
  3. Risposte: 2
    Ultimo Messaggio: 04/10/16, 18:49
  4. Ridimensionare selettivamente celle di dimensioni diverse sulla stessa colonna.
    Di Davide1969 nel forum Domande su Excel in generale
    Risposte: 2
    Ultimo Messaggio: 15/06/16, 22:33
  5. Risposte: 2
    Ultimo Messaggio: 02/02/16, 14:54

Permessi di Scrittura

  • Tu non puoi inviare nuove discussioni
  • Tu non puoi inviare risposte
  • Tu non puoi inviare allegati
  • Tu non puoi modificare i tuoi messaggi
  •